NAME
caxpy - Compute y := alpha * x + y
SYNOPSIS
SUBROUTINE CAXPY (N, ALPHA, X, INCY, Y, INCY )
COMPLEX ALPHA
INTEGER INCX, INCY, N
COMPLEX X( * ), Y( * )
#include <sunperf.h>
void caxpy (int n, complex *za, complex *zx, int incx, com-
plex *zy, int incy);
PURPOSE
CAXPY - Compute y := alpha * x + y where alpha is a scalar
and x and y are n-vectors.
PARAMETERS
N - INTEGER.
On entry, N specifies the number of elements in
the vector. N must be at least one for the sub-
routine to have any visible effect. Unchanged on
exit.
ALPHA - COMPLEX.
On entry, ALPHA specifies the scalar alpha.
Unchanged on exit.
X - COMPLEX
array of DIMENSION at least ( 1 + ( n - 1 )*abs(
INCX ) ). Before entry, the incremented array X
must contain the vector x. Unchanged on exit.
INCX - INTEGER.
On entry, INCX specifies the increment for the
elements of X. INCX must not be zero. Unchanged
on exit.
Y - COMPLEX
array of DIMENSION at least ( 1 + ( m - 1 )*abs(
INCY ) ). On entry, the incremented array Y must
contain the vector y. On exit, Y is overwritten by
the updated vector y.
INCY - INTEGER.
On entry, INCY specifies the increment for the
elements of Y. INCY must not be zero. Unchanged
on exit.
